Today we read a great "spooky" story today called The Little Old Lady Who Was Not Afraid of Anything, by Linda Williams.  This is a story the children love to join in to tell, and it's a really great story to work with identifying events in a story.  We will work more with the story tomorrow, but today we made puppets to practice retelling.  I have included a YouTube video of the story so the children can tell you the story then you can watch together to see how they did!  Enjoy!
